WALTER MOHR

Funeral services for Walter H. (Pete) Mohr, 73, a former Hartley resident, were conducted Sunday, March 23, at 2:30 p.m. in the Trinity United Church of Christ in Hartley, with Rev. Robert Bell of Everly, Iowa, officiating.

Walter Hans Mohr, youngest son of Henry and Katherin (Frahm) Morh, was born May 28, 1905 at Ogden, Iowa. At an early age, the family moved to the Hartley vicinity where he received his education and grew to manhood.

He was married to Eunice Wiese, also of Hartley, on December 25, 1926, in Sioux City, Iowa, where they resided for six years before returning to Hartley where Mr. Mohr was plant manager for Fairmont Foods for fifteen years.

In 1947, the Mohrs moved to Valley City, North Dakota, where Mr. Mohr became assistant manager of the Land O'Lakes Creamer Company plant, which position he held for twenty-one years.

Mr. Mohr became ill in August 1969. He underwent surgery in Fargo. He never fully recovered and his health continued to fail until his death on March 19, 1969.

He leaves to mourn his passing his wife, Eunice; three children, Richard of Sioux Falls, South Dakota, Gloria (Mrs. Richard Harris) of Everly, Iowa, and Kay C. of Brooten, Minnesota; nine grandchildren; five sisters: Mrs. L.E. (Margaret) Mielke, Mrs. Fred (Mary) Miller, and Mrs. Fred (Martha) Hazlett, all of Hartley, Iowa; Mrs. Rufus (Ann) Young of Monticello, Iowa, and Mrs. Henry (Lydia) Bertoch of Alexandria, Minnesota; several brothers-in-law, numerous nieces and nephews and many friends.

He was preceded in death by his parents, five brothers and three sisters.

Services were conducted Saturday, March 22, at 11:00 a.m. at the Congregational Church in Valley City, North Dakota, with Rev. James MacArthur officiating. The Peterson-Olson Funeral Home was in charge of arrangements and brought the remains to the Baumgarten Funeral Home, which conducted the services here.

Interment was in the family plot in Pleasant View Cemetery in Hartley, Iowa.

Hartley (Iowa) Sentinel, 3 Apr 1969, p9
